Little Lives, Big Questions Part 2
Nuffield Health Tunbridge Wells Hospital is delighted to invite parents and carers to Little Lives, Big Questions – a series of informative and supportive paediatric talks led by our experienced consultants.
Held at our Tunbridge Wells Fitness and Wellbeing Centre, these evenings are designed to help parents better understand some of the most common health concerns affecting babies and children, with plenty of time for questions and discussion.
Whether you’re navigating the early months of parenthood or supporting an active growing child, these sessions aim to provide clear guidance, reassurance, and expert advice.
5.30pm – 6.30pm Mr Kumar Somasundaram, Consultant Paediatrician - Managing Crying in Babies
Crying is a normal part of infancy, but excessive or
unsettled crying can be upsetting and exhausting for parents. This session will
explore common reasons babies cry, signs of colic or reflux, what is normal,
and practical strategies to help soothe babies and reassure parents.
6.45pm – 7.45pm Mr Rohit Gowda, Consultant Paediatrician - Tummy Troubles Explained
Abdominal pain, constipation, reflux, and feeding issues are common worries for
parents. This session looks at the most frequent tummy problems in children,
what causes them, how they are managed, and when symptoms may require further
investigation or reassurance.
8.00pm – 9.00pm Mr Sri Mahalingam, Consultant Ear, Nose and
Throat Surgeon
Sniffles, Snoring & Recurrent Earache
Runny noses, ear infections, and snoring can all affect a child’s sleep, behaviour, and development. This talk will explain common ear, nose and throat conditions, when treatment is required, and when referral to a specialist may be helpful.
